For anyone interests in this. There are three local kindergartens near XinTianDi (about 0.5 km); however, one is too small and the other two are full. As a compromise, we find another local (bilingual) kindergarten 1.8 km from XinTianDi. Its name is Kid Castle-Xujiahui Road Kindergarten. It has school bus. Each class has two teachers, one Chinese and one English. They seem to emphasize on *classes* and *learning* a lot; facility looks good; the place looks organized; has multimedia music room and computer room. Was told, "our 5-year olds can type their names in Chinese!"
Monthly school fee is about RMB2200.00; semester misc fee is about RMB500.00.
Disclaimer: since we won't move to Shanghai till November, we don't yet have first hand experience to tell from our 3-year old. Hope they don't emphasize too much learning but forget to let them have fun.  |

Hi Suzy,
If I remember them correctly, these are the three close to XTD:
1. 开心果幼儿园 Kai Xing Guo Kindergarten (may be closest to XTD)
#238 Tai Cang Road(太仓路); Phone:63280742
2. 思南路幼儿园 Si Nan Road Kindergarten (may be the most well known one)
Main campus: #91, Si Nan Road (思南路); phone: 021-64731464
3. 大同幼儿园 Da Tong Kindergarten (the very small one)
#48 Nan Chang Road (南昌路); Phone: 021-63725355
